如果partNum超出了str中的部件数:该函数返回一个空字符串。 如果partNum为 0:则split_part引发INVALID_INDEX_OF_ZERO。 示例 SQL >SELECT'->'|| split_part('Hello,world,!',',',1) ||'<-'; ->Hello<- >SELECT'->'|| split_part('Hello,world,!',',',2) ||'<-'; ->world<- >SELECT'...
SQL Server 中鲜为人知的字符串分割函数 SQL Server 提供了强大的函数来帮助我们完成这些任务。让我们深入探索一下 SQL Server 中的常用字符串分割函数。 1.SUBSTRING() SUBSTRING()函数可以从源字符串中提取子串。它接收 3 个参数: 源字符串, 起始位置和长度。 SELECT SUBSTRING('Hello, SQL Server', 8, 10)...
split_part是 Hive SQL 中一个用于字符串操作的函数,它可以将一个字符串按照指定的分隔符进行分割,并返回分割后特定位置的子字符串。该函数的基本语法如下: split_part(stringtext,stringdelimiter,intindex) 1. string text: 需要进行分割的字符串。 string delimiter: 用于分割字符串的字符。 int index: 指定返回...
Split_Part函数的等效项是Split,它也可以实现相同的功能。Split函数的语法如下: 代码语言:txt 复制 Split[string; delimiter] 除了Split_Part和Split函数,Kdb+还提供了许多其他的字符串处理函数,如Join、Reverse、Upper、Lower等,可以满足不同的字符串处理需求。 在Kdb+中,可以使用q语言进行开发。q语言是一种专为Kdb...
SPLIT_PART函数的基本语法如下: SPLIT_PART(string, delimiter, field) string:要拆分的输入字符串。 delimiter:用于拆分字符串的分隔符。 field:要返回的部分的索引,索引从1开始。 SPLIT_PART函数会根据指定的分隔符将字符串拆分成若干个部分,并返回第field个部分。如果索引超出了拆分后的部分数,则返回空字符串。
雪花的split_part函数没有明确的限制。split_part函数是雪花数据库中的一个字符串函数,用于根据指定的分隔符将字符串拆分成多个部分,并返回指定位置的部分。该函数的语法如下: split_part(string, delimiter, position) 其中,string是要拆分的字符串,delimiter是分隔符,position是要返回的部分的位置。 该函数的使用没...
用指定的分隔符拆分字符串,并返回指定位置的部分内容。 语法 SPLIT_PART(string,delimiter,position) 参数 string 要拆分的字符串列、表达式或字符串文本。字符串可以是 CHAR 或 VARCHAR。 分隔符 分隔符字符串指示输入string的部分。 如果delimiter是文本,则将其括在单引号中。
SPLIT_PART 函数用于将字符串按照指定的分隔符分割,并返回指定索引位置的子字符串。与其他函数的区别在于,SPLIT_PART 是用于字符串的分割和提取操作,而其他函数可能用于其他类型的数据操作,比如数学运算、逻辑判断等。另外,SPLIT_PART 是专门用于字符串分割的函数,可以方便地从一个字符串中提取需要的部分,而其他函数...
要优化 SQL 中 split_part 函数的使用,可以考虑以下几点:1. 减少 split_part 函数的调用次数:在查询中多次调用 split_part 函数会增加查询的复杂度和执行时间,...
函数原型为:split_part(stringtext,delimitertext,fieldint),其中string为要操作的字符串,delimiter为分隔符,field为要提取子字符串的位置索引。 split_part函数的语法特点是,它可以接受任意长度的多字节字符串参数,但是在处理字节流时,有一定的局限性。例如,当字节流为中文或日文时,由于这些语言每个字符都是双字节,...